Ohio River Valley Viticultural Area ... We're Number 1

Here's something I didn't know until today:

The Ohio River Valley is the largest officially recognized viticultural (wine-producing) area in the United States.

However, some folks in the Upper Mississippi River Valley plan to form a larger area.
